5. Backup & Disaster Recovery Data
Rubic maintains backup and recovery systems to protect platform integrity and availability.
Backup Characteristics:
Backups may persist temporarily after account deletion
Backup data is stored securely and is not directly accessible to customers
Backup retention does not extend account access or service rights
Backup data is overwritten or purged according to internal retention schedules
Backup retention is necessary for disaster recovery, security, and continuity purposes.

10. No Guarantee of Immediate or Complete Erasure
Due to:
Backup systems
Log retention
Legal and security obligations
Rubic does not guarantee immediate or absolute erasure of all data upon deletion or cancellation requests.
Data is deleted in accordance with this Policy and applicable law.
